1. Color range
The choice of colors for walls, furniture and bed linen is of great importance for creating a calm atmosphere in the bedroom. Pastels and neutrals such as white, grey, pale blue, soft pink and beige can help create a relaxing and peaceful atmosphere. Dark or bright colors, on the contrary, can cause anxiety and excitement.
Pillows, blankets and linens can also play an important role in creating a calm atmosphere. Keep in mind that natural fabrics such as cotton, linen or silk can be more pleasant to the touch and promote relaxation.
2. Lighting
Lighting is another key factor in creating a calm atmosphere in the bedroom. It is necessary to use soft light, which can create a pleasant and relaxing atmosphere. To do this, you can use various light sources, such as table lamps, candles or wall sconces.
It is also important to consider the brightness of the lighting in the bedroom. It should be bright enough to create a comfortable environment, but not too bright to interfere with sleep.
3. Furniture arrangement
The arrangement of the furniture is another factor that can influence the creation of a calm atmosphere in the bedroom. Furniture should be arranged in such a way as to create space for relaxation and rest. It is necessary to provide enough space for movement, do not overload the room with unnecessary things.
In addition, the arrangement of furniture can affect the perception of light and sound in a room. For example, it is better to position the bed so that the window is behind it to minimize street noise and protect from the bright rays of the sun in the morning. It is also not recommended to place furniture that can create barriers between different corners of the room, as this can create a feeling of clutter and unease.
4. Plants
Plants can not only decorate the bedroom, but also create a healthier and more peaceful atmosphere. They are able to purify the air of harmful substances, increase oxygen levels and reduce carbon dioxide levels, which can help improve the quality of sleep. Some of the best bedroom plants include aloe, bracken, sansevieria, gerbera, lilies, and violets.

The main source of heat loss in the cold season is windows. Replacing old wooden frames with metal-plastic double-glazed windows will increase the room temperature by 1-5˚C. Glazing of balconies, sealing gaps in window frames, installing a second front door, floor insulation gives the same effect. To increase the efficiency of heating radiators, a heat-reflecting foil screen installed at the back will help. If there are old cast-iron batteries, it is better to replace them with aluminum or metal ones, since they have a 40-50% higher heat transfer level. Another rational solution is the installation of thermostats and meters. Saving heat, we save electricity, as additional heating of the room is not required.
Only residents of arid countries understand the value of this resource. Despite the fact that 70% of the planet is covered with water, only 1% of this good is suitable for drinking. Saving water is not difficult: you need to install a meter, monitor the condition of taps and toilet bowls. After all, even a small leak imperceptibly winds up a few extra cubes in a month. When washing and brushing your teeth, washing dishes, it is not necessary to turn on the water at full power, a thin jet is often enough. Replacing swivel taps with lever ones, installing spray nozzles saves up to 15% of water. Taking a shower uses 20 times less water than taking a bath. When washing dishes by hand, water is spent 5 times more than in a dishwasher. Installation of such equipment will save up to 8 cubic meters per year. The same goes for washing machines. However, when choosing a model, one should be guided not by the price, but by the characteristics: min and max water consumption per cycle, energy saving class (optimally A, even better AA). It is good if the technique will be with different automatic programs.

What is the difference between chipboard, MDF and fiberboard? This question is of interest, perhaps, to everyone who has encountered purchase of furniture and finishing materials, as it directly affects their cost. In this article, we will describe the technical characteristics, as well as the pros and cons of these materials, which will help you make your choice.
It is produced from shavings and sawdust of any low-value wood, both coniferous and hardwood, and a special binder, mainly synthetic resins (formaldehyde resins), using the hot pressing method.
Chipboard is the most widely used material for economy class furniture and office furniture, as it has a low price. Compared to natural wood, they swell less from moisture and are less combustible, and also have good heat and sound insulation properties. More biostability. However, chipboard is not recommended for use in rooms with high humidity, as it has the lowest moisture resistance property and when used in very humid rooms, chipboard swells and deforms. Chipboard is not a highly environmentally friendly material, since when using furniture made of chipboard, a small amount of formaldehyde is released into the air, which can adversely affect health. But the minimum amount of formaldehyde emitted is completely safe for humans, so you should pay attention to the type of chipboard (E1 or E2). E1 is more environmentally friendly, its formaldehyde emission rate is noticeably lower. Austrian and German chipboards are considered the most environmentally friendly.
Produced from very small particles of wood. With the help of special equipment, small cubes are made from woodworking waste, which are subsequently processed with steam under pressure. After that, the manufactured material is crushed using a grinder. And the resulting small wood particles are held together with a special solution.
MDF is used in the manufacture of doors. Also, this material is used to make durable trims, facades for furniture, canvases for painting, as well as various linings for entrance doors. MDF products are considered the most moisture resistant and can be used in rooms with humidity up to 80%, while for wood products this parameter should not exceed 60%. Also, MDF has the properties of excellent planarity of the web surfaces, surface hardness and impact resistance. MDF is a very environmentally friendly material, since lignin and paraffin are used as a binder. Prices for MDF are quite high, this is due, among other things, to the lack of established production on the territory of Ukraine.
Manufacturing technology is very similar to MDF. It is made by hot pressing evenly ground wood pulp impregnated with synthetic resins, with the inclusion of some additives in the mass that improve its properties, such as moisture resistance and strength, preventing their destruction. The plates themselves are made using the wet pressing method, in connection with which one of the sides of the finished fiberboard is always rough, and the other, smooth, is covered with a film (laminated or laminated).
It is used in the production of finishing works, as the back walls of cabinets, the bottom of drawers, etc. It has a low price with high durability, but the range of use of this material is small. In the most expensive furniture, plywood is used instead of fiberboard, but in terms of its performance properties, it is not much better. Fiberboard is a very moisture resistant and highly environmentally friendly material.

Even 5-10 years ago, two-level apartments were not common, given that it is difficult and expensive to make one from two single-level apartments. In 2018, finding such housing is easier – especially on the upper floors of new buildings. However, the choice and purchase of two-level apartments is only the beginning. The planning and zoning of the apartment will take much more time, which should be taken with special responsibility – changing the arrangement of rooms and other elements in this case will be much more difficult than with ordinary single-level housing.
Considering the layout options for two-level housing, first of all, they look at the ratio of the area of the first and second levels. If there is a difference in these indicators, a space is formed in the apartment, called “double-height”. Its difference is double height and improved aesthetics – it is pleasant to be in such a room, and the apartment itself gives the impression of its own two-story house.
Among other advantages of a double-height space, it is worth noting:
Among the disadvantages of the “second world” can be called a decrease in the total area of housing. Instead of a double-height space, there could be 1-2 extra rooms. In addition, in high rooms, noise spreads better, it is more difficult to heat them, and it will take almost as much time to clean large chandeliers and long curtains as it would to completely clean in an ordinary apartment.
Due to the shortcomings of double-height spaces, many owners of two-level apartments choose “one-light” zoning, the advantages of which are a large area and good sound insulation, and among the minuses are not such a spectacular interior and visual division of housing into 2 parts. Although each buyer (or owner who decides to redevelop) housing may have their own preferences regarding the configuration of single- and double-height spaces, they will be the main criterion for choosing the appropriate option.
When distributing the premises over the floors of two-level apartments, the correct zoning is an important point. Among the most common mistakes are:
Particular attention should be paid to communications and the location of the stairs. Indeed, if it is relatively easy to move partitions and doors (and, moreover, change the purpose of rooms), moving a riser and a flight of stairs will require high costs. Sometimes, to move the stairs to a new location, you may even need additional openings in the interfloor ceiling or their expansion. It is difficult to do this, but it is even more difficult to agree on such a redevelopment and draw up all the necessary documents.
Rational use of available space will help to make a two-level apartment comfortable. So, to reduce the area that the staircase will occupy, they prefer the option on hinged balusters. If a straight flight of stairs is chosen for safety reasons, the space below it is used as a pantry or closet.
Two-level housing will be comfortable and cozy if there is more space on the first floor than on the second. The upper part of the housing is given to the bedrooms and ancillary facilities (office, workshop). On the lower level are the kitchen, dining room (for large apartments) and living room – the areas in which the inhabitants of the apartment spend the most time.

Digital airbrushing ArtROBO – is a technology of direct colorful printing on vertical surfaces prepared for painting.
The digital complex is equipped with a semi-automatic coordinate binding system and a surface curvature tracking system, which allows you to work with almost any objects.
When printing, acrylic resin-based inks are used, then the surfaces are treated with various finish coatings, depending on the upcoming operating conditions.
It should be noted that luminescent paints are used to obtain an image with a glow effect. This is a more time-consuming and expensive process of applying drawings, since the image is applied not in one, but in 2-3 passes. The speed of drawing such a pattern is within 0.3 – 1 sq.m. in hour.
Compare: the speed of applying a picture with ordinary paints is 0.7 – 3.5 sq.m. per hour.
In both cases, a photorealistic image with wide format printing quality is obtained.
In addition, the images have excellent operational qualities. They are light-resistant, not afraid of humidity and temperature fluctuations. In turn, these qualities allow the use of technology in exteriors.

The production of architectural decoration is a complex and science-intensive process. Historically, architectural decor was made of gypsum, the main advantage of which is the ability to obtain products of any configuration, no matter how complex it may be. The development of science and technology has led to the emergence of other technologies for obtaining such products. The most technologically similar to gypsum production is the production of architectural decor elements from polyurethane foam.
High-density polyurethane foams are absolutely inert and do not interact with the external environment. Due to their properties, they are widely used in various industries, including medicine, as bone implants. The density of all Europlast products is 300 kg/m3. This is the minimum density at which production does not require the use of hydrochlorofluorocarbons. To obtain products of lower density, it is necessary to use hydrochlorofluorocarbon, which not only remains in the products, but during operation is released into the atmosphere of the room for a long time. Concern Evroplast, taking care of the health of its consumers, deliberately goes to increase the cost of production (manufacturing of products with high density), abandoning the technology with the use of dangerous hydrochlorofluorocarbon. In addition, high density provides less shrinkage and greater hardness of products. The process of production of decorative elements from polyurethane foam can be divided into several stages.
This is one of the most important and defining stages of the entire production, because the appearance of products depends on the mold. Unlike gypsum technology, polyurethane foam does not just harden, but greatly increases in volume, filling the entire internal space of the mold. The result is a product that exactly repeats the shape. Since the mold is subjected to a lot of pressure, it is important that it is strong. On the other hand, the rigidity of the form leads to the limitation of products in configuration. After all, the element must subsequently be removed from the rigid form without damaging it. At this stage, many manufacturers are faced with the problem of the impossibility of casting products with a non-standard configuration and with a complex pattern. Europlast makes molds from carbon fiber – a modern material that has greater strength than metal. This technology arose as a result of the conversion of technologies of the military-industrial complex and allows you to create the most durable molds for casting products of almost any configuration. The equipment used without repair withstands at least 50,000 castings and ensures high reproducibility: the cast parts are almost indistinguishable from each other. The production of polyurethane foams is a very complex process, in the understanding of which there are still many blank spots. For example, the same raw material can give different results on different equipment. It is no secret that one batch of raw materials may differ slightly from another. Sometimes this difference is insignificant, but it happens that such differences cause a noticeable change in the properties of the final products. Our own component preparation laboratory eliminates such problems. Specialists of the Europlast laboratory carry out incoming control of all raw materials used in the manufacture of components, according to the results of which the technological department corrects the recipe. Then an experimental process is carried out, during which the recipe is finalized. And only then the raw material goes into production.
For the production of its products, Evroplast uses the most modern equipment from the world’s leading manufacturers – CANNON, KRAUSMAFFEI, SIEMENS, ABB. It allows, firstly, to automate the process of mixing and dosing of components. Each machine is equipped with a powerful computer, the memory of which contains the filling programs for each product, which eliminates the negative impact of the human factor. Secondly, modern devices are installed on all machines, which allow very accurate dosing of components and maintaining their ratio for a long time. Elements of architectural decor differ significantly in weight, dimensions, configuration. Certain parts require specialized equipment and special settings in the organization of the manufacturing process. For example, for casting large and elongated parts, such as columns, a high-capacity pouring machine is required, and for casting wall decor parts, with low productivity and high dosing accuracy. In order to obtain the excellent quality of all products, the Europlast plant has 4 pouring sections, which provide optimal manufacturing conditions for various parts.
The overall dimensions of the elements after pouring always differ from each other, while all Europlast products fit exactly together. High precision of articulation of parts with each other after pouring is achieved with the help of their additional precision processing. Two identical elements will exactly match in profile, and if a fragment of any size is cut from any part of the product, the two remaining fragments will also exactly match in profile. Europlast technologies take into account the inertness of polyurethane foam. If special measures are not taken, the finished material cannot be glued and painted (glue and paint do not penetrate inside, the glue does not dissolve the surface layer). During mechanical processing, a surface specially prepared for gluing is created on the inside of the products. Before painting products, a special polyurethane primer is applied to them, which has good adhesion to polyurethane foam products and allows the paint to adhere well to their surface.

How to choose an interior door? In this article, we will not touch on the issues of price and appearance (design) of doors, it depends on the design and interior creation and the availability of funds that you are willing to spend. Here we will touch upon the issues of reliability, durability and ease of use of doors. We want to note right away that the choice of doors should be taken more carefully than, for example, the choice of furniture, since, unlike the latter, the replacement of doors entails repair work, often accompanied by a replacement of wall decoration.
Such doors are valued because of solid precious woods: teak, oak, walnut, hornbeam, expensive tropical woods. They are considered the most durable. This is due to both the lifespan of the wood itself and the manufacturing technology of these doors. They are made using self-locking spike joints, without glue. The panels are attached to the grooves. Like any expensive thing, such doors require special attention and maintenance of the microclimate, otherwise they will not be able to serve you for a long time, no matter how well they are made.
As a rule, paneled doors made of softwood, primarily pine, are very common when creating interiors of country houses in the Country style. Such doors are produced mainly without finishing (only impregnation with special oils) and have a low cost. In design of a modern apartment such doors are not used, as they do not match the style, nor by the microclimate of the room.
The manufacturing technology is even more complex than fine wood panel doors. The materials are produced by pasting an array of cheap wood with MDF or HDF, material, thereby increasing resistance to changes in temperature and humidity. More MDF is pasted over with precious wood veneer and treated with various impregnations and varnishes, just like doors made of expensive solid wood. The service life of such doors is less than that of panel doors made of precious wood, but also quite long. The low price in terms of price-quality-service life ratio, the absence of problems during operation, even in rooms with extreme macroclimate, as well as the richness and beauty of the texture of valuable wood, make such doors very popular in the finishing materials market.
The most common type of door on the modern market of finishing materials. According to GOST 6629-88, panel doors are made on the basis of a panel:
The price range of panel doors is quite large. The difference in price depends on the materials used in the manufacture of the canvas – the quality and thickness of the MDF (in the cheapest versions of the “wet” fiberboard), the quality of the cardboard and the cell size of the honeycomb (from 10x10mm to 40×40, i.e. from 100 sq. mm per cell until 1600). But the main difference in price “runs” during the finishing. The finishing of panel doors is carried out both with artificial materials and with natural veneer of valuable wood species.
